Why Garage Door Springs Are Not A DIY Repair

Posted on: 13 April 2023

Garage door springs have a lifespan of anywhere from just a few years to nearly a decade depending on how often you use your garage door and how well you care for the springs. Unfortunately, most homeowners will have to replace their garage door springs at least once, if not several times while they own the house. One common mistake that homeowners make is trying to replace those springs themselves. Here's a look at some of the reasons why you should call a professional instead.

Key Aspects Of A Well-Built Senior Care Facility

Posted on: 31 March 2023

When designing a senior living facility, certain key areas should be focused on to ensure the safety and comfort of its residents. Every detail of a senior living facility should be designed with the elderly's needs in mind. This article will outline some of the major aspects of a well-built senior care facility. Layout and Accessibility  When designing a senior living facility, consider accessibility for the elderly. The facility should be designed with ramps, low counters, and wide doorways to make mobility easier for those in wheelchairs or walkers.

3 Reasons To Paint An Interior Door A Different Color

Posted on: 16 March 2023

In most of the rooms throughout your home, an interior door that leads into a room will have the same color of paint as the walls of the room. There's nothing wrong with this look, but you may wish to consider a different approach. One popular trend to consider is keeping the walls of the room a neutral color but painting the door in a vibrant hue. A local painting contractor can not only do the work for you, but may also be able to look at some rooms in your home and suggest some unique colors for the doors.
